At 04:26 PM 6/15/2004, Rowland, Krisa W ERDC-ITL-MS Contractor wrote:Also - if I try and reconfigure as root - then I can't get it to recognize where gcc is - even if I add it to the path - but it will as myself. Isn't that crazy?No, not if your gcc is installed some place weird like /usr/local/bin... root doesn't have /usr/local in it's path, but non-root users do.Fix your GCC install.
